다음을 통해 공유


STRINGTOBOOLEAN - Cosmos DB의 쿼리 언어(Azure 및 패브릭)

이 함수는 STRINGTOBOOLEAN 문자열 식을 부울로 변환합니다.

부울로 변환된 문자열 식을 반환하는 NoSQL용 Azure Cosmos DB 시스템 함수입니다.

구문

STRINGTOBOOLEAN(<string_expr>)

Arguments

Description
string_expr 문자열 식입니다.

반환 형식

부울 값을 반환합니다.

예시

이 섹션에는 이 쿼리 언어 구문을 사용하는 방법에 대한 예제가 포함되어 있습니다.

문자열을 부울로 변환

이 예제 STRINGTOBOOLEAN 에서 함수는 다양한 문자열 값을 부울로 구문 분석하는 데 사용됩니다.

SELECT VALUE {
  parseBooleanString: STRINGTOBOOLEAN("true"),
  parseWithPrefix: STRINGTOBOOLEAN("true  "),
  parseWithSuffix: STRINGTOBOOLEAN("  false"),
  parseWithWhitespace: STRINGTOBOOLEAN("  false  "),
  parseBoolean: STRINGTOBOOLEAN(true),
  parseUndefined: STRINGTOBOOLEAN(undefined),
  parseNull: STRINGTOBOOLEAN(null)
}
[
  {
    "parseBooleanString": true,
    "parseWithPrefix": true,
    "parseWithSuffix": false,
    "parseWithWhitespace": false
  }
]

비고

  • 이 함수는 인덱스 활용하지 않습니다.